 +==== measures ====
 +what can be measured?
 +  * plant physiology
 +    * moisture levels / tension 
 +    * action potentials (Reiss)
 +    * [...] 
 +  * environmental
 +    * soil moisture
 +    * pH level 
 +    * temperature (eg. [[http://cache.national.com/ds/LM/LM35.pdf][LM35]])
 +    * humidity 
 +    * uv / light levels

 +==== data formats ===
 +EEML "Extended Environments Markup Language (EEML), a protocol for sharing sensor data between remote responsive environments, both physical and virtual." http://www.eeml.org/
 +
 +"SensorML is an Open Geospatial Consortium standard markup language (using XML Schema) for providing descriptions of sensor systems. By design it supports a wide range of sensors, including both dynamic and stationary platforms and both in-situ and remote sensors." [[wp>SensorML]]
